Excellant for self study |
| First work through Basics including the workbook, then A Summer Greek Reader (for practice with easy syntax and additional vocablary memorization), then this. After that read the Greek New Testament with A Reader's Lexicon to cut down on time spent thumbing through the lexicon. Start with the gospels or Acts. |

Good for going it alone |
| If you are trying to learn Greek by your lonesome, this book is a good resource. I first tried using Machen, which is a painful experience. Mounce has a good system, which introduces things in an orderly fashion, keeps memorization to a minimum (although there is no way around a good bit of it), and all of the exercises and examples come directly from the NT. |
